  1. Lead and manage a team of intake specialists, providing guidance, direction, and support to ensure the efficient and accurate processing of patient information.
  2. Monitor and maintain department performance metrics to ensure timely and accurate completion of tasks.
  3. Train and onboard new team members, ensuring they have the necessary skills and knowledge to perform their job duties effectively.
  4. Collaborate with other departments and stakeholders to identify and implement process improvements to enhance the efficiency and effectiveness of the intake process.
  5. Develop and maintain training materials and standard operating procedures for the intake department.
  6. Act as a point of contact for escalated issues and provide timely and effective resolution.
  7. Conduct regular performance evaluations and provide feedback and coaching to team members to support their growth and development.
  8. Stay informed and up-to-date on industry trends, regulations, and best practices related to healthcare and patient intake.
  9. Ensure compliance with all relevant laws, regulations, and company policies related to patient privacy and data security.
  10. Promote a positive and supportive work environment that fosters teamwork, open communication, and a strong commitment to quality and excellence.

About Novartis

Novartis AG develops, manufactures, and markets healthcare products. It operates through the following segments: Pharmaceuticals, Alcon, Sandoz, Vaccines & Diagnostics, and Consumer Health. The Pharmaceuticals segment provides patent-protected prescription medicines. The Alcon segment offers surgical, ophthalmic pharmaceuticals, and vision care products. The Sandoz segment provides generic pharmaceuticals. The Vaccines & Diagnostics segment provides human vaccines and blood testing diagnostics.
